| import unittest |
|
|
| from transformers import load_tool |
| from transformers.tools.agent_types import AGENT_TYPE_MAPPING |
|
|
| from .test_tools_common import ToolTesterMixin, output_types |
|
|
|
|
| class TranslationToolTester(unittest.TestCase, ToolTesterMixin): |
| def setUp(self): |
| self.tool = load_tool("translation") |
| self.tool.setup() |
| self.remote_tool = load_tool("translation", remote=True) |
|
|
| def test_exact_match_arg(self): |
| result = self.tool("Hey, what's up?", src_lang="English", tgt_lang="French") |
| self.assertEqual(result, "- Hé, comment ça va?") |
|
|
| def test_exact_match_arg_remote(self): |
| result = self.remote_tool("Hey, what's up?", src_lang="English", tgt_lang="French") |
| self.assertEqual(result, "- Hé, comment ça va?") |
|
|
| def test_exact_match_kwarg(self): |
| result = self.tool(text="Hey, what's up?", src_lang="English", tgt_lang="French") |
| self.assertEqual(result, "- Hé, comment ça va?") |
|
|
| def test_exact_match_kwarg_remote(self): |
| result = self.remote_tool(text="Hey, what's up?", src_lang="English", tgt_lang="French") |
| self.assertEqual(result, "- Hé, comment ça va?") |
|
|
| def test_call(self): |
| inputs = ["Hey, what's up?", "English", "Spanish"] |
| outputs = self.tool(*inputs) |
|
|
| |
| if len(self.tool.outputs) == 1: |
| outputs = [outputs] |
|
|
| self.assertListEqual(output_types(outputs), self.tool.outputs) |
|
|
| def test_agent_types_outputs(self): |
| inputs = ["Hey, what's up?", "English", "Spanish"] |
| outputs = self.tool(*inputs) |
|
|
| if not isinstance(outputs, list): |
| outputs = [outputs] |
|
|
| self.assertEqual(len(outputs), len(self.tool.outputs)) |
|
|
| for output, output_type in zip(outputs, self.tool.outputs): |
| agent_type = AGENT_TYPE_MAPPING[output_type] |
| self.assertTrue(isinstance(output, agent_type)) |
|
|
| def test_agent_types_inputs(self): |
| inputs = ["Hey, what's up?", "English", "Spanish"] |
|
|
| _inputs = [] |
|
|
| for _input, input_type in zip(inputs, self.tool.inputs): |
| if isinstance(input_type, list): |
| _inputs.append([AGENT_TYPE_MAPPING[_input_type](_input) for _input_type in input_type]) |
| else: |
| _inputs.append(AGENT_TYPE_MAPPING[input_type](_input)) |
|
|
| |
| outputs = self.tool(*inputs) |
|
|
| if not isinstance(outputs, list): |
| outputs = [outputs] |
|
|
| self.assertEqual(len(outputs), len(self.tool.outputs)) |
